Abstract:
Cleavage Under Targets and Tagmentation (CUT&Tag) provides high-resolution sequencing libraries for profiling diverse chromatin components. This protocol details the steps to generate CUT&Tag libraries from fresh or frozen tissues. This CUT&Tag workflow has nine main steps: isolation of nuclei from tissues, binding of nuclei to Concanavalin A-coated beads, binding of the primary antibody, binding of the secondary antibody, binding pA-Tn5 adapter complex, tagmentation, DNA extraction, PCR, and post-PCR cleanup and size selection. This protocol enabled us to generate and sequence CUT&Tag libraries across a broad range of fresh and frozen tissue types.
摘要:
靶标下的切割和标签(CUT&Tag)提供高分辨率测序文库,用于分析不同的染色质组分。该协议详细说明了从新鲜或冷冻组织生成CUT&标签库的步骤。这个CUT&标记工作流程有九个主要步骤:从组织中分离细胞核,细胞核与刀豆蛋白A包被的珠子结合,一级抗体的结合,第二抗体的结合,结合pA-Tn5衔接子复合物,标签化,DNA提取,PCR,以及PCR后的清理和大小选择。该协议使我们能够在广泛的新鲜和冷冻组织类型中生成和测序CUT&标签库。
